David Lomidze
SentencedArticle 353¹(1) – Assault on a police officer.
Case Details
David Lomidze was arrested on December 1, 2024, accused of throwing a Molotov cocktail that damaged a water cannon vehicle. Police beat him in the street, then in a minibus for 40 minutes away from cameras. No officers were held accountable. Initially detained under administrative charges; 48 hours later charges were escalated. Video evidence is of such poor quality it's impossible to identify Lomidze. The court refused forensic analysis; identification made solely by riot police officers.

Personal Background
53-year-old craftsman. Has elderly mother, wife, three children, and two grandchildren.
⚕Health Issues
Severe back pain from beatings, aggravated by prior spinal surgery. Denied medical relief.
